我已经看了很多这个问题,但没有find答案,我希望你能帮助我
我正在使用一些Python脚本来更新和计算一些存储在MySQL Server 5.5上的mysql表中的一些值。
但是我们遇到了closures电脑的电源故障,当我们再次打开电源时,一切正常,但是我们完全失去了与MySQL的连接。 基本上任何运行mysql服务的尝试都会产生这样的信息:
http://imageshack.us/photo/my-images/718/mysqlerror.png/
mysqld服务没有运行。 我们试着重新启动它,基本上按照mysql文档站点中提供的步骤进行:
dev.mysql.com/doc/refman/5.5/en/can-not-connect-to-server.html
和
dev.mysql.com/doc/refman/5.5/en/starting-server.html
但没有解决问题。 当inputnetworking启动mysql时,我得到的消息:
“系统错误5.访问被拒绝”
在阅读文档后,我发现了这个命令:mysqld –debug,它提供了这样的信息:
http://imageshack.us/photo/my-images/833/mysqlddebug.png/
我不知道这个消息是否可以给出任何事情的暗示,我希望它能做到。 我们已经尝试了在互联网上find的所有东西:重新启动服务器,重新启动mysql服务器,运行更新等,但是mysql服务仍然无法启动。
并没有创build错误日志…(但我们仍然不知道我们的表是否可以)
在所有数据库上运行一个mysqlcheck,我得到以下消息:
“mysqlcheck:Got Error 2003:尝试连接时无法连接到'localhost'(10061)上的Mysql Server”。
有谁知道如何解决这个问题,或者至less知道如何恢复停电之前我们已经拥有的桌子?
我非常感谢任何帮助! 如果你需要更多的信息,请让我知道! TNX!
尝试以pipe理员身份运行命令提示符。 您应该能够右键单击命令提示符快捷方式,然后单击“以pipe理员身份运行”。
然后,执行您之前尝试的命令。
你的mysqld进程在运行吗? 您可以打开任务pipe理器>进程选项卡并按图像名称进行sorting。
或者试试这个:打开命令提示符并进入mysql安装的bin目录,如果你的mysql服务是msql,则input:
。\ mysql \ bin \ sc qc mysql您应该看到如下所示:[SC] GetServiceConfig SUCCESS
SERVICE_NAME:mysql TYPE:10 WIN32_OWN_PROCESS START_TYPE:3 DEMAND_START …
如果没有,那么你需要启动/设置为服务的MySQL。
你可以做两件事: